Output 53806c1d0d026991a6d573ef0aa30b8201ea2afb1ddca572c5a0801cd19cbc47:16

value
27690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85b05e391c41fd31a7e05efdac9635a8e478ec9d OP_EQUAL
address
3Dsu5KnmSKzWbR9JzzWqWDbLACA9oJiCJ2
transaction
53806c1d0d026991a6d573ef0aa30b8201ea2afb1ddca572c5a0801cd19cbc47
spent
true